Output 6a128866cd8cd4b16bfa9ff9e2da8bc120da1862bba1b47394d1e5cfee968891:0

value
576623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 754605b1175b871701d29fdc4b48de684cadf195 OP_EQUAL
address
3CP6sDbZMgAkKrMokPd2E9zZxh6dRuvxVX
transaction
6a128866cd8cd4b16bfa9ff9e2da8bc120da1862bba1b47394d1e5cfee968891
spent
true